Dance 4 Peace spreads message through movement
The nonprofit organization trains “PeaceMovers” to instruct teachers, parents and monitors on using dance to fight bullying and foster empathy.
5 Seconds
PeaceMover Aysha Upchurch works in September 2011 at a regional training in Takoma Park. The Dance 4 Peace program reaches out to schools and community centers to instruct young people on ways that dance can enhance social skills.
